What is an entry level information system?

An Entry Level Information System job involves managing, maintaining, and troubleshooting computer systems, networks, and databases within an organization. Professionals in this role may assist with technical support, system analysis, and cybersecurity tasks. They typically work under the supervision of senior IT staff, gaining hands-on experience with software, hardware, and IT infrastructure. Strong analytical, problem-solving, and communication skills are essential for success in this role.

What are the typical responsibilities of an entry level information system?

As an Entry Level Information System professional, your daily responsibilities may include monitoring system performance, assisting with software installations and updates, resolving technical issues, and providing basic IT support to staff members. You might also help maintain user accounts, update documentation, and collaborate with more senior IT team members on larger projects. This role serves as a crucial support function within the IT department and offers opportunities to learn about different aspects of information systems and technology. Over time, you can gain valuable experience and pursue advancement to specialized roles within IT, such as systems analyst, network administrator, or cybersecurity specialist.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ed for an entry level information system?

To thrive as an Entry Level Information System professional, you need a foundational understanding of information technology concepts, system administration, and troubleshooting, often supported by a relevant bachelor’s degree or equivalent experience. Familiarity with database management systems, enterprise software (such as Microsoft Office Suite), and basic knowledge of networking and security protocols are typically required, with certifications like CompTIA A+ or Microsoft Certified: Fundamentals being advantageous. Strong analytical thinking, attention to detail, and effective communication skills help individuals excel in team-based and customer support environments. These competencies ensure reliable system operations and efficient problem resolution, which are essential for supporting organizational technology needs.

Job description

Virginia Pediatric Group is seeking a dedicated Administrative Assistant with IT Support responsibilities to join our team.

The position will coordinate, facilitate, and organize administrative activities related to the day-to-day operations and logistics of the practice, while also providing some IT support, including troubleshooting technical issues, setting up equipment, installing software, and providing guidance to users.

Specific duties will include the following:


Administrative Functions:

  • Maintain and update patient records, ensuring confidentiality and compliance with healthcare regulations
  • Manage the intake process, including forms, consent documentation, and insurance verification
  • Assist with office management tasks, including inventory management and ordering supplies as needed
  • Place purchase orders for office supplies, including IT equipment
  • Handle outgoing mail, collect, and distribute incoming mails.


IT Support:

  • Perform the installation, maintenance, upgrade, and repairs of computer and network equipment.
  • Install and upgrade Electronic Health Record Software, Practice Management Software, standard word processing, spread sheet, desktop publishing, and Internet software packages as requested.
  • Perform regular and on-demand system backups and recoveries.
  • Monitor and troubleshoot hardware, software, and networking problems as they occur.
  • Provide guidance and assist users with connecting to network resources.


Qualification Required:

  • Education: High school diploma with Comptia A+ Certification
  • Experience: 2+ years of experience in a help desk or network environment including troubleshooting, Microsoft Windows 10/11.
  • Experience troubleshooting healthcare systems (EMR/HER/PM software)
  •   Detailed-oriented, well organized, people-oriented, and reliable
  • Must be able to occasionally travel between 4 offices (Fairfax, Herndon, Great Falls and Aldie)
